Neil Doncaster feels Rangers were ‘entirely unfair’ to call for his suspension

Neil Doncaster File Photo
(Image credit: Jeff Holmes)

Scottish Professional Football League chief executive Neil Doncaster has described Rangers’ calls for his suspension as “entirely unfair”.

Rangers claimed to have “alarming” evidence that raised serious concerns over the process of the recent SPFL vote on the termination of the season and called for Doncaster and SPFL legal advisor Rod McKenzie to be suspended, but refused to hand over any proof.
